Schnauzers must not eat what can be fatal if eaten

Schnauzers can't eat chocolate, which can cause heart disease and other life-threatening problems; can't eat harsh spices, which can affect a dog's sense of smell; and can't eat raw liver, which can cause bone problems.

Things Schnauzers Can't Eat: Chocolate

The caffeine and theobromine contained in chocolate have a serious impact on the heart and central nervous system of dogs, and the power of chocolate is accumulated in the body and takes a long time to metabolize, so chocolate is a deadly food for dogs. .

What Schnauzers can't eat: Milk and dairy products

Ice cream, frozen milk, and dairy products are a big influence on underdeveloped puppies, and not suitable for grown-up dogs. The dog's stomach is not suitable for foods such as milk and dairy products, so even heated milk or other dairy products should be fed as little as possible.

Things Schnauzers Can't Eat: Salted Foods

Dried salty foods are high in salt, such as salted fish, dried shrimps, dried fish, bacon, and cured meats. They should not be fed to Schnauzers or other dogs, as they will irritate the dog's stomach and kidneys.

Things Schnauzers can't eat: Onions

Onions should never be fed to Schnauzers, and neither should other breeds of dogs. Because onions are highly toxic to the blood of dogs, eating them can cause acute anemia and even endanger their lives.

Things Schnauzers Can't Eat: Spices

Foods containing too much pepper and mustard should not be eaten by Schnauzers, otherwise it will cause oral ulcers and gastrointestinal ulcers. When feeding dogs chicken, duck, and goose, pick out the bones of the meat first, otherwise the dog will pierce the throat and stomach when swallowing these bones.

Things Schnauzers can't eat: persimmons, grapes

Persimmon seeds can cause intestinal obstruction and enteritis in dogs. Grapes and raisins can cause kidney failure in dogs.

What Schnauzers can't eat: Raw eggs

Raw egg whites contain a protein called avidin, which depletes the dog's body of vitamin H. Vitamin H is an essential nutrient for dogs to grow and promote healthy fur, and raw eggs often contain germs.

What Schnauzers can't eat: Raw meat and poultry

A dog's immune system cannot adapt to captive poultry and meat. The most common species of Salmonella and Bacillus are very dangerous to dogs.
